Kunal Kamra Controversy: The controversy over stand-up comedian Kunal Kamra is increasing. Meanwhile, Mumbai Police has sent a third notice to Kunal Kamra for his comment on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Eknath Shinde.
Third Summons Issued Against Kunal Kamra
In fact, Comedian Kunal Kamra has been asked to appear for clarification on the derogatory remarks against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Eknath Shinde in his latest stand-up video "Naya Bharat". According to Mumbai Police, Kunal Kamra has been summoned to record his statement on April 5. Kamra has been booked at Khar Police Station under Sections 353 (statements causing public mischief) and 356 (2) (defamation) of the Indian Penal Code. These complaints from various Shiv Sena workers were transferred to Khar from various police stations.
The comedian is on interim anticipatory bail till April 7
Mumbai Police officials said, "Mumbai Police has issued a third notice to Kunal Kamra to appear and record his statement on 5 April. Mumbai Police had called Kunal Kamra twice earlier for questioning, but he did not appear". Police officials visited Kamra's house in Mumbai on Monday, 31 March 2025, to determine whether he would appear before them. Kunal Kamra is on interim anticipatory bail until 7 April by the Madras High Court, allowing him to approach courts in Maharashtra.
This is how the controversy started (Kunal Kamra Row)
For your information, let us tell you that Kunal Kamra had shared a video of himself on social media in which he is singing a song mocking Deputy CM Shinde. This angered the workers of the Shinde faction. Referring to the separated factions of Shiv Sena and Nationalist Congress Party (NCP), Kunal Kamra said that "one man" started this trend and used the word 'gaddar' (traitor) to describe that person. After Kamra's video surfaced, on the night of March 23, supporters of the Shiv Sena Shinde faction vandalized the Habitat Comedy Club in Khar area of Mumbai. Shinde said, 'This same Kamra had commented on the Supreme Court, the Prime Minister, Arnab Goswami and some industrialists. This is not freedom of expression. This is working for someone'.
